Indeed, it depends on who one is addressing, does it not? Identity politics treats class as merely another identity while much of what passes as Marxism treats oppression in a pretty sloppy fashion. I am not claiming that we should strive for a golden mean of some sort, but that a revolutionary class politics has a lot of work to do to take other forms of oppression seriously and theorize them more adequately, which in itself requires a radical rethinking of our conceptions of class. At the same time, oppostion to oppressions which are devoid of class content happen to overlook the relationship of those oppressions to the kind of alienated human relations which Marx posits as the source of class itself, and therefore of all other oppression. There is no end to heterosexism without an end to alienated social relations between human beings, which I think you and I agree means the end of class society.
